Align
Now works with both EU and US clients!
Adds a slash command /align that shows a grid to aid visual alignment of elements. /align again to hide the grid.
The grid has dashed lines every 16 pixels, a solid line every 32 pixels and centre lines in red. The origin for the main grid is the top left corner.
The latest version accepts "/align d" as an alternative command - this gives you a decimal grid (dotted line every 10 pixels, solid line every 20) NOTE: If a grid is already showing it will just hide the grid and not show a new one.

Updates
Version 1 starts the grid at the top left. This means the lines may not quite line up with the centre.
Version 1a aligns the grid with the centre lines. This means the lines may not quite line up with the boundaries.
Version 1b adds a decimal grid
Version 1c fix for Patch
